7393 is a odd prime number that follows 7392 and precedes 7394. As a prime number, 7393 is only divisible by 1 and itself. It holds a unique position in the sequence of integers. Its prime factorization is simply 7393. 7393 is classified as a deficient number based on the sum of its proper divisors. In computer science, 7393 is represented as 1110011100001 in binary and 1CE1 in hexadecimal.

Is 7393 a prime number?
7393 is prime, meaning it is only divisible by 1 and itself.
What is the prime factorization of 7393?
7393 is already prime, so the factorization is simply 7393.
How is 7393 represented in binary and hexadecimal?
7393 converts to 1110011100001 in binary and 1CE1 in hexadecimal, which are helpful for computer science applications.
Is 7393 a perfect square, cube, or triangular number?
7393 is not a perfect square, is not a perfect cube, and is not triangular.
What are the digit sum and digital root of 7393?
The digits sum to 22, producing a digital root of 4. These tests power divisibility shortcuts for 3 and 9.
